什么是数字签名证书
数字签名证书是一种用于验证和保护电子文档、电子邮件、网站和其他数字信息的身份和完整性的加密技术,它通过使用公钥加密算法和私钥解密算法,确保发送方的身份真实性和信息的完整性,防止信息被篡改或伪造。
(图片来源网络,侵删)数字签名证书的核心是一对密钥:公钥和私钥,公钥是公开的,任何人都可以获取并用于加密信息;而私钥则是私有的,只有拥有者才能解密和使用,当发送方使用自己的私钥对信息进行加密时,接收方可以使用发送方的公钥进行解密,从而确保信息的真实性和完整性。
数字签名证书的工作原理如下:
1. 生成密钥对:发送方第一生成一对密钥,包括一个公钥和一个私钥,这对密钥是通过复杂的数学算法生成的,具有很高的安全性。
(图片来源网络,侵删)2. 创建数字签名:发送方使用自己的私钥对要发送的信息进行加密,生成一个唯一的数字签名,这个数字签名包含了发送方的公钥和原始信息的特征值。
3. 发送信息:发送方将加密后的信息和数字签名一起发送给接收方,由于数字签名中包含了发送方的公钥,接收方可以使用这个公钥来验证数字签名的真实性。
4. 验证数字签名:接收方收到加密后的信息和数字签名后,第一使用发送方的公钥对数字签名进行解密,得到原始信息的特征值,接收方对收到的原始信息进行相同的计算,得到一个新的特征值,如果这两个特征值相同,说明信息在传输过程中没有被篡改,且确实是由发送方发送的。
(图片来源网络,侵删)5. 解密信息:接收方使用自己的私钥对加密后的信息进行解密,得到原始的信息内容,由于只有拥有私钥的人才能解密信息,因此可以确保信息的安全性。
数字签名证书的主要优势如下:
1. 身份验证:数字签名证书可以确保发送方的身份真实性,防止冒充他人发送信息。
2. 信息完整性:数字签名证书可以确保信息的完整性,防止信息在传输过程中被篡改或伪造。
3. 抗抵赖:数字签名证书可以防止发送方在事后否认自己发送过的信息,提高信息的可信度。
4. 安全性:数字签名证书采用了复杂的加密算法,具有较高的安全性,难以被破解。
5. 法律效力:数字签名证书具有法律效力,可以在法律纠纷中作为证据使用。
数字签名证书是一种有效的安全技术,可以确保电子文档、电子邮件、网站和其他数字信息的身份真实性和完整性,防止信息被篡改或伪造,随着互联网的普及和电子商务的发展,数字签名证书在各个领域的应用越来越广泛。
与本文相关的问题与解答:
问题1:数字签名证书有哪些应用场景?
答:数字签名证书广泛应用于各种需要确保身份真实性和信息完整性的场景,如电子合同签署、电子邮件加密、网上银行交易、电子政务等。
问题2:数字签名证书如何存储和管理?
答:数字签名证书通常存储在用户的计算机、移动设备或其他安全存储介质上,用户需要妥善保管私钥,防止泄露,用户还需要定期更新证书,以确保其有效性和安全性。
问题3:数字签名证书是否具有法律效力?
答:是的,数字签名证书具有法律效力,在许多国家和地区,数字签名证书已经得到了法律的认可和保护,可以在法律纠纷中作为证据使用。
问题4:如何获取数字签名证书?
答:用户可以向权威的数字证书颁发机构(如VeriSign、DigiCert等)申请数字签名证书,申请过程通常包括提交个人信息、验证身份、支付费用等步骤,获得证书后,用户需要将其安装到自己的设备上,并妥善保管私钥。